Primary Responsibilities Estimating & Preconstruction
  • Prepare detailed cost estimates for heavy civil and site development projects.
  • Review plans, specifications, geotechnical reports, and bid documents to determine project scope and construction requirements.
  • Perform comprehensive quantity takeoffs for earthwork, excavation, utilities, roadway construction, stormwater systems, and related infrastructure.
  • Develop conceptual, budgetary, negotiated, and competitive bid estimates.
  • Analyze project risks, constructability, sequencing, and logistical challenges.
  • Prepare complete bid proposals, scope clarifications, exclusions, and qualifications.
Bid Management
  • Manage multiple estimates simultaneously while meeting strict bid deadlines.
  • Attend pre-bid meetings and project walkthroughs.
  • Review RFIs, addenda, and revised construction documents.
  • Coordinate subcontractor and supplier pricing.
  • Evaluate subcontractor proposals for completeness and accuracy.
  • Participate in bid review meetings with company leadership.
  • Support contract negotiations after project award.
Cost Development

Prepare accurate estimates for:

  • Earthwork and mass grading
  • Excavation
  • Site balancing
  • Land clearing
  • Demolition
  • Underground water systems
  • Sanitary sewer systems
  • Storm drainage systems
  • Stormwater repair
  • Roadway construction
  • Asphalt paving
  • Concrete paving
  • Erosion control
  • Utility crossings
  • Dewatering
  • Temporary traffic control
  • Mobilization
  • Equipment utilization
  • Labor productivity
  • Materials procurement
  • General conditions
  • Contingencies
